BLS metro-level wage data places Floor Layers, Except Carpet, Wood, and Hard Tiles pay in Kansas City, MO-KS at a median of $50,140 per year ($24.10/hr/hour), drawn from the OEWS May 2025 release for this Metropolitan Statistical Area. Compared to the national median of $56,460, Kansas City pays 11% below, which typically tracks with a lower local cost of living or smaller specialized-employer cluster. Approximately 170 floor layers, except carpet, wood, and hard tiless are employed across the Kansas City MSA in SOC 47-2042.
The Kansas City pay distribution spans from $35,500 at the 10th percentile to $73,930 at the 90th — a 2.1× spread that reflects experience tenure, specialization, employer size, and the difference between public-sector, nonprofit, and private-sector compensation inside the metro. The 25th percentile sits at $42,390 and the 75th at $58,540, so half of Kansas City-based floor layers, except carpet, wood, and hard tiless earn within that middle band.
